Essential Guidance for Agricultural Operations

The following insights are intended to provide valuable direction for optimizing farm management and enhancing operational efficiency. These points address key areas critical for sustained success in the agricultural sector.

Tip 1: Prioritize Soil Health Assessment. Conduct regular soil testing to determine nutrient levels and pH balance. Addressing imbalances proactively can optimize fertilizer application and improve crop yields. For example, correcting a nitrogen deficiency through targeted fertilization ensures healthy plant growth.

Tip 2: Implement Integrated Pest Management. Adopt strategies that combine biological controls, cultural practices, and chemical applications judiciously. Regularly monitor crops for pests and diseases to intervene early and minimize potential damage. Consider introducing beneficial insects to control pest populations naturally.

Tip 3: Optimize Irrigation Practices. Employ water-efficient irrigation techniques such as drip irrigation or micro-sprinklers to conserve water resources and reduce water costs. Monitor soil moisture levels to avoid over- or under-watering, which can negatively impact crop health.

Tip 4: Maintain Equipment Regularly. Implement a preventative maintenance schedule for all farm machinery. Regular servicing extends the lifespan of equipment, reduces the risk of breakdowns during critical periods, and ensures efficient operation. This includes tasks such as oil changes, filter replacements, and tire inspections.

Tip 5: Plan Crop Rotations Strategically. Rotate crops to improve soil health, reduce pest and disease pressure, and enhance nutrient utilization. A well-planned crop rotation can break disease cycles and reduce reliance on chemical inputs. For example, alternating legumes with cereal crops can improve soil nitrogen levels.

Tip 6: Diversify Crop Selection. Consider diversifying crop varieties to mitigate risks associated with weather patterns, market fluctuations, and pest outbreaks. A wider range of crops can provide a more stable income stream and improve overall farm resilience.

Tip 7: Implement Precise Fertilizer Application. Utilize GPS-guided fertilizer application to ensure accurate and efficient nutrient delivery. This minimizes fertilizer waste, reduces environmental impact, and optimizes crop growth. Consider variable rate application based on soil mapping data.

6. Inventory Management

6. Inventory Management, Farm Supply

Effective inventory management is crucial for “smiths farm supply” to operate efficiently and meet the demands of its agricultural clientele. Balancing supply with demand is paramount to avoid stockouts and minimize holding costs, directly impacting profitability and customer satisfaction.

  • Demand Forecasting and Seasonal Adjustments

    Accurate demand forecasting is essential for optimizing inventory levels. “Smiths farm supply” must anticipate seasonal fluctuations in demand for various agricultural inputs, such as seeds, fertilizers, and pesticides. Historical sales data, weather patterns, and crop planting schedules should inform these forecasts. Inaccurate forecasting can lead to stockouts during peak seasons, resulting in lost sales and dissatisfied customers, or excessive inventory during off-seasons, increasing storage costs and potentially leading to product spoilage.

  • Supply Chain Optimization and Supplier Relationships

    Efficient inventory management relies on a well-optimized supply chain and strong relationships with suppliers. “Smiths farm supply” must establish reliable sourcing channels to ensure a consistent flow of goods. Negotiating favorable terms with suppliers, such as flexible delivery schedules and volume discounts, can significantly reduce procurement costs and improve inventory turnover. Disruptions in the supply chain, due to weather events or supplier issues, can lead to inventory shortages and negatively impact operations. Proactive communication and risk mitigation strategies are crucial for maintaining a stable supply of goods.

  • Storage and Handling Procedures

    Proper storage and handling procedures are critical for preserving the quality and integrity of agricultural inputs. “Smiths farm supply” must invest in appropriate storage facilities to protect inventory from environmental factors such as moisture, temperature extremes, and pests. Implementing strict inventory rotation practices, such as “first-in, first-out” (FIFO), ensures that older products are sold before they expire or degrade. Improper storage and handling can result in product spoilage, contamination, or damage, leading to financial losses and potential liability issues.

  • Technology Integration and Data Analysis

    Technology plays a vital role in modern inventory management. “Smiths farm supply” can leverage inventory management software, barcode scanning systems, and data analytics tools to improve accuracy, efficiency, and decision-making. Real-time inventory tracking provides valuable insights into product movement, sales trends, and stock levels. Data analysis can identify slow-moving items, optimize reorder points, and improve demand forecasting accuracy. Integrating technology into inventory management processes streamlines operations, reduces manual errors, and enhances overall profitability.
